General information: 

The changed structure of the EFA22 has also an impact on the Alpbach Seminars. In order to better integrate the seminars into the overall programme, the seminars will take place every morning for the whole duration of the event. Scholarship holders will decide on two seminars, each of the seminars running for one week. The interplay of scientific, creative and skills-orientated activities, together with the conference programme of panels, workshops and plenary debates in the afternoons turn Alpbach into a place of innovative knowledge transfer and holistic learning. 

Seminar Assistants play an important role in ensuring the success of the seminars. Therefore, it is essential for Seminar Assistants to be in Alpbach for the whole duration of the event, as they will be supporting two seminars (one in each week). Throughout the time Seminar Assistants will be supported by the team responsible for the Alpbach Seminars.   

 

Being a “Seminar Assistant” 

Your tasks:

  1. Making an active contribution to the delivery of the seminar programme 
  2. Providing logistical and administrative support for the successful delivery of the seminars 
  3. Acting as the communication link between the seminars and the EFA office
  4. Supporting two seminars – one during each week
  5. Producing a creative report of each seminar
  6. Participate at an onboarding event before the event EFA22 
  7. Strengthening the EFA network after the event by initiating an active contribution to and promotion of the European Forum Alpbach in your home country

 

Your profile:

  1. You have already been a scholarship holder at the EFA & you are not older than 35 years 
  2. You would like to get more involved in the Alpbach Seminars in terms of content and organisation 
  3. You hold at least a bachelor degree and probably a Masters degree or more
  4. You have experience of or are interested in a range of methods of learning and teaching 
  5. You are willing to support two assigned seminars in a variety of ways
  6. You would like to strengthen the Alpbach community after the EFA22
  7. You can participate at the event for its whole duration (20 August – 2 September 2022) 

 

Your benefits:

  1. You will expand and deepen your Alpbach experience 
  2. You will be a key part of the Alpbach community – with connections to the Forum Alpbach Network (FAN) 
  3. You will be supported throughout your responsibilities by Prof. Howard Williamson 
  4. You will have the opportunity to be involved in the EFA programme throughout your stay 
  5. You will have a side programme of activities tailored to your needs 
  6. Your EFA22 participation costs, accommodation costs and daily allowances will be covered
  7. Your accommodation can be organised by EFA (overnight stay in shared rooms near Alpbach).
